KUALA LUMPUR, Dec 22 After waiting for nearly nine-months, a South Korean family court ruled that K-pop star Goo Hara s inheritance be split 6:4 between her surviving family members.
K-pop news portal
Soompi reported that the Gwangju Family Court had ordered Goo s brother Ho-in be given 60 per cent while Goo s estranged mother gets 40 percent of the late singer s inheritance.
